10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Vancouver

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by vehicle type and specific features. Whether you require an SUV for additional space, a convertible for summer outings, or an economical car for budget-friendly travel, utilise the filters on Expedia to help identify the best option for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ental prices can vary depending on demand, so it's advisable to secure your vehicle well ahead of your trip. Booking in advance typically allows you to obtain lower rates and ensures better availability, particularly during peak se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ller vehicles are generally more affordable to rent and easier to manoeuvre in busy areas. Mid-size rentals strike a good balance between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under the age of 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and certain vehicle categories—such as SUVs or premium models—might not be available. This can also apply to renters over 70 years old. Always verify the age requirements prior to booking.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ate under a full-to-full fuel policy, which requires you to return the car with a full tank to avoid extra fees. This is usually the most favourable option. Others may provide full-to-empty or prepaid fuelling choices, which are also acceptable. Just ensure you return the car empty in this instance.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but it may be worthwhile for the added convenience.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ies exclusively acc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unnecessary expenses and provide peace of mind should anything unexpected occur during your trip. It’s straightforward to add car rental insurance when you book with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you're planning long road trips, seek r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ent additional char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's licence is essential for renting a car.

Best time to rent a car in and around Vancouver

The best time to rent a car in and around Vancouver is February, when prices are slightly low and demand is moderately low, offering great value. March and April also present good opportunities, with similar pricing and average demand. However, summer months like July and August are notably more expensive, with high demand as visitors flock to the area. Consequently, it's wise to plan ahead during these peak months when rental prices tend to rise.

How old do you have to be to rent a car in Vancouver?
If you're aged 21 and over, you can rent a car in Vancouver. Be aware that rental providers will charge an additional fee if you're a young driver, which is meant to cover the higher accident or damage risk involved. Also, young drivers often aren't permitted to rent larger vehicles and luxury cars. Carefully read the terms and conditions before booking to avoid any problems when it's time to pick up the keys.
What do you need to rent a car in Vancouver?
Any rental company you choose will ask for these two things — your driver's licence and credit card. If you want to opt out of the supplier's insurance plan, proof of other coverage will also likely be needed. Read through your policy so you know what to bring when it's time to pick up the keys.
